A new local multiscale Fourier analysis for medical imaging

TL;DR: The Stockwell transform (ST), recently developed for geophysics, combines features of the Fourier, Gabor and wavelet transforms; it reveals frequency variation over time or space and is a potentially effective tool to visualize, analyze, and process medical imaging data.
